Customs and duties (outside EU)

For non-EU destinations, local customs duties and taxes may apply on arrival. These charges are determined by local customs authorities and are the recipient's responsibility.

For US customers: Orders under $800 are duty-free under current US customs regulations (Section 321 de minimis exemption).

For UK customers: Orders over £135 are subject to VAT.
